Python读取并展示PostgreSQL表数据教程

需积分: 5 0 下载量 74 浏览量 更新于2024-11-14 收藏 6.95MB RAR 举报
资源摘要信息:"getpg_data.rar" 标题解读: 给定的文件标题为"getpg_data.rar",从标题中可以解读出该资源可能是一个关于从PostgreSQL(pg)数据库中提取数据并进行处理的压缩包文件。由于文件格式为.rar,我们可以推断这是一个压缩文件,需要使用相应的解压缩工具(如WinRAR、7-Zip等)来打开。RAR文件格式是一种较早的压缩文件格式,相比ZIP格式通常可以提供更好的压缩率。 描述解读: 描述中提到"python读取pg数据库的表数据,把数据写到页面",这说明该资源包含了一个用Python编写的脚本或程序,用于连接到PostgreSQL数据库,执行查询操作,获取表中的数据,并将这些数据输出或展示在一个Web页面上。描述中还提到了"绝对不会后悔",可能是在强调该脚本或程序的质量和实用性。另外,描述中的"详细问题可以咨询我"表明提供者愿意针对使用中的问题提供帮助,这可能意味着该资源背后有一个可访问的技术支持或开发者。 标签解读: 给定的标签为"python",这表明该资源与Python编程语言紧密相关。PostgreSQL是一个开源的对象关系数据库系统,它经常与Python一起使用,特别是在数据驱动的应用程序和Web开发中。Python有许多用于操作数据库的库,尤其是PostgreSQL,例如psycopg2,这是一个流行的PostgreSQL适配器,可以用来在Python应用程序中执行SQL语句、获取数据等。 压缩包子文件名称列表: 文件名称列表中仅包含"getpg_data",这可能意味着压缩包中包含了一个名为"getpg_data"的文件,但没有提供文件扩展名。由于没有具体说明文件的类型(如.py表示Python脚本文件,.sql表示SQL文件等),我们可以合理假设该文件是与Python相关的源代码文件,例如一个Python脚本或模块。 基于以上信息,以下是相关的知识点: 1. PostgreSQL数据库操作:了解PostgreSQL的基本概念,包括如何安装、配置和管理数据库服务器。熟悉PostgreSQL的数据类型、SQL语法和事务处理。 2. Python编程语言:掌握Python的基础语法,了解如何进行面向对象编程,熟悉异常处理、文件操作等高级特性。 3. 数据库连接和查询:学习如何使用Python中的数据库适配器,如psycopg2,连接到PostgreSQL数据库。掌握执行SQL查询,处理结果集,并进行数据的增删改查操作。 4. Web页面数据展示:理解如何使用Python框架(例如Flask或Django)将数据库查询结果展示在Web页面上。这包括了解HTML、CSS和JavaScript的基础知识,以便创建动态网页。 5. 解压缩工具的使用:了解RAR文件格式和如何使用WinRAR或7-Zip等工具来解压RAR文件,获取压缩包中的内容。 6. Python包和模块管理:熟悉Python包的概念以及如何创建和管理Python模块。了解如何使用pip(Python包管理器)来安装和管理第三方库。 7. 错误处理和调试:学习如何在Python程序中处理潜在的错误和异常,包括对数据库操作中可能遇到的特定错误进行处理。 8. 代码维护和文档编写:了解编写清晰、可维护代码的重要性,包括注释、文档字符串和版本控制实践。 通过掌握上述知识点,开发者将能够有效地使用该"getpg_data.rar"资源来从PostgreSQL数据库读取数据,并将这些数据以网页的形式呈现。同时,开发者也可以根据自身需求修改和扩展该脚本或程序,以适应不同的应用场景。